    Getting There

    Walking

    If you are starting from the main square, Plaza de Armas, walk towards the Calle del Medio. Continue straight until you reach the intersection with Avenida El Sol. Turn left on Avenida El Sol and walk for about 10 minutes. You will pass several shops and restaurants. Manos de la Comunidad will be on your right, just after the intersection with Calle Saphi.

    Walking

    From San Pedro Market, head southwest along Avenida San Pedro. After a few minutes, turn right onto Calle Saphi. Continue straight until you reach Avenida El Sol, then turn left. Manos de la Comunidad will be on your right, just a short walk from the intersection.

    Public Transport (Minibus)

    If you are near the San Blas area, take a minibus heading towards Avenida El Sol. Get off at the stop near Plaza de Armas. From there, follow the walking directions to the location, which is about a 15-minute walk from the Plaza.

    Local tips

    Visit early in the morning to avoid crowds and have a more personal shopping experience.
    Bring cash, as some vendors may not accept credit cards.
    Take your time to engage with the artisans and learn about their craft.
    Look for workshops or demonstrations to see artisans in action.
    Don’t hesitate to negotiate prices; it’s common practice in local markets.

    Discover more about Manos de la Comunidad

    Manos de la Comunidad, located in the vibrant city of Cusco, is a must-visit destination for tourists who appreciate authentic Peruvian handicrafts. This marketplace is not just a shopping venue; it is a celebration of the rich cultural heritage of Peru, showcasing the talents of local artisans who pour their skills and passion into every piece they create. From colorful textiles woven with traditional patterns to intricately designed pottery and unique jewelry, the variety of handcrafted goods available is staggering. As you wander through the aisles, you’ll encounter the lively atmosphere filled with the sounds of artisans at work, giving you a glimpse into their creative processes. This direct interaction with the makers adds a personal touch to your shopping experience, making it more than just a transaction. Each item tells a story, reflecting the history and culture of the region. Moreover, shopping at Manos de la Comunidad supports local communities, ensuring that your purchases contribute to sustainable livelihoods. The marketplace operates with a commitment to fair trade, which means that the artisans receive a fair wage for their work. This ethical approach not only empowers the community but also enhances the overall experience for visitors, who can feel good about their contributions. For those visiting Cusco, Manos de la Comunidad serves as a perfect place to find unique souvenirs that embody the spirit of Peru. Whether you’re looking for a gift or a personal keepsake, this destination provides an opportunity to take a piece of Peruvian culture home with you.
